This randomized controlled trial will test whether a recently developed community-based intergenerational mentoring program known as Generation Xchange (GenX) can enhance antiviral resistance in older African-American women and men in a low-SES urban community. Additional studies will identify the biological processes that promote resistance to respiratory virus infections and viral disease in older African-American women and men.

详细描述

This randomized controlled intervention trial (planned n=160) will test whether participation in the Generation Xchange (GenX) intergenerational mentoring program can reduces vulnerability to respiratory virus infections (COVID, influenzas, colds), increase antiviral immune activity (Type I interferon responses), and reduce inflammatory immune activity in older African-American women and men living in a socioeconomically disadvantaged urban community. Blood samples will also be collected to determine which biological factors are most important in protecting older African-Americans from respiratory virus infection, and which of those factors is affected by the GenX intervention.

结局指标

主要结局

Concentration of Type I interferon antiviral activity (bioassay International Units / mL)

时间窗: 10 months

Blood cell production of Type I interferon activity will stimulated by exposure to a fixed dose of model viral protein (TruCulture Resiquimod R848 tubes) and quantifying Type I interferon concentration in the cell culture supernatant fluid using the standard Armstrong bioassay (Armstrong, J.A. Cytopathic effect inhibition assay for interferon: microculture plate assay. Methods in enzymology 78, 381-387 (1981).) Antiviral activity is quantified as International Units of Interferon activity / mL.

次要结局

  • Respiratory virus antibody concentration (WHO international units BAU/mL)(10 months)
  • Pro-inflammatory cytokine concentration (pg/mL)(10 months)
